Palestinian Resistance confronts Israeli West Bank raid

The Resistance in the West Bank city of Tulkarm confronted an invading unit of the Israeli occupation forces in Deir al-Ghousoun.

The al-Aqsa Brigades - Tulkarm Battalion announced Saturday that it engaged in fierce confrontations with Israeli occupation forces raiding the town of Deir al-Ghousoun in the northwest of the occupied West Bank.

The confrontations took place after an IOF unit stormed the town, with the Resistance fighters using IEDs and assault rifles to attack the invading forces.

The Israeli occupation forces surrounded a house in Deir al-Ghousoun as the confrontations were taking place before the IOF called for back-up.

A bulldozer aided in the storming of the Palestinian town before demolishing the house that was surrounded by the occupation forces for up to four hours.

As the confrontations were unfolding, the Israeli occupation forces deployed snipers on the rooftops of the town's buildings to cover for the soldiers carrying out the military operation.

Israeli occupation forces stormed the city of Halhul, north of al-Khalil, and fired stun grenades and tear gas, amid fierce confrontations. Local sources reported that confrontations erupted between Palestinian youths and the occupation forces in the al-Arroub refugee camp in al-Khalil.

The occupation forces also stormed the city of Dura, south of al-Khalil in the West Bank, and fired stun grenades and tear gas.

The IOF conducted patrols in different parts of the city before withdrawing toward the military tower in the Khursa neighborhood, south of the city.

The occupation forces also stormed the areas of Qizoun, Shaaba Junction, and Wad al-Hariya, in addition to the town of Sa'ir north of al-Khalil, firing stun grenades and tear gas at the locals confronting their incursion in the village of al-Raihiya, south of al-Khalil.

Earlier, a Palestinian youth was seriously wounded when the occupation forces stormed Anabta village in Tulkarm, where he was shot in the head with live ammunition.

The occupation forces stormed the village with a number of vehicles, and armed confrontations erupted between the occupation forces and Palestinian Resistance fighters who confronted the invasion.

In Nablus, a Palestinian child was also injured by Israeli occupation forces when they stormed Qusra village.

In the same context, a number of settlers stormed the southern area of the town and provoked the residents, which led to confrontations with Palestinian youths, after which IOF vehicles stormed the village amid heavy fire, which resulted in the injury of a 14-year-old Palestinian child.

Similarly, another group of settlers under the protection of the occupation forces attacked Palestinian vehicles near the Israeli military checkpoint of Beit El at the northern entrance to Ramallah and al-Bireh governorate, damaging some vehicles without any injuries reported.
